Abstract
Previous methods for studying the scattering properties of perfectly conducting periodic structures were derived with basis on the boundary conditions the fields must satisfy at the structure surface; in this work it is shown that those scattering properties plus the induced current along the structure surface can be studied through a different mathematical formulation exclusively derived with basis on the scattered far-fields characteristics. Complementary periodic structures, periodic structures with dielectric layers and corrugated waveguides were also studied as applications of the method. Numerical results obtained with the new method are shown to be in good agreement with the results obtained by other methods and also with experimental data.
